CERT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2022 in Review

164 of the 6,340 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Certara (CERT) for Q1 2022, worth a combined $1.85B — down 22% from $2.37B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 31 funds opened new CERT positions and 27 closed out — a net gain of 4 holders — while 76 added to existing stakes and 42 trimmed.

The largest buyer was ArrowMark Colorado Holdings, opening a new position worth an estimated $69.9M. The largest seller was Capital World Investors, exiting entirely with an estimated $35.7M sold.
